2-Chloro-5-(trifluoromethyl)benzoyl chloride is a chemical compound that is predominantly used as a reagent in organic synthesis. It holds the systematic name of 2-chloro-5-(trifluoromethyl)benzoyl chloride and is known to be soluble in organic solvents. The trifluoromethyl group in 2-CHLORO-5-(TRIFLUOROMETHYL)BENZOYL CHLORIDE lends it unique properties that make it useful in various applications. Precisely handled under controlled conditions due to its reactive nature, this chemical occasionally serves as an ingredient in the manufacture of p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als, and specific types of polymers. Given its reactivity, it must be managed with absolute caution, respecting all safety and handling requirements.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 657-05-6 includes 6 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 3 digits, 6,5 and 7 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 0 and 5 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 657-05:
(5*6)+(4*5)+(3*7)+(2*0)+(1*5)=76
76 % 10 = 6
So 657-05-6 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Synthesis and biological evaluation of 1,2,4-triazole-3-thione and 1,3,4-oxadiazole-2-thione as antimycobacterial agents

Sonawane, Amol D.,Rode, Navnath D.,Nawale, Laxman,Joshi, Rohini R.,Joshi, Ramesh A.,Likhite, Anjali P.,Sarkar, Dhiman

, p. 200 - 209 (2017/07/13)

Resistance among dormant mycobacteria leading to multidrug-resistant and extremely drug-resistant tuberculosis is one of the major threats. Hence, a series of 1,2,4-triazole-3-thione and 1,3,4-oxadiazole-2-thione derivatives (4a–5c) have been synthesized and screened for their antitubercular activity against Mycobacterium tuberculosis H37Ra (H37Ra). The triazolethiones 4b and 4v showed high antitubercular activity (both MIC and IC50) against the dormant H37Ra by in vitro and ex vivo. They were shown to have more specificity toward mycobacteria than other Gram-negative and Gram-positive pathogenic bacteria. The cytotoxicity was almost insignificant up to 100?μg/ml against THP-1, A549, and PANC-1 human cancer cell lines, and solubility was high in aqueous solution, indicating the potential of developing these compounds further as novel therapeutics against tuberculosis infection.

Structure-Based Optimization of a Small Molecule Antagonist of the Interaction between WD Repeat-Containing Protein 5 (WDR5) and Mixed-Lineage Leukemia 1 (MLL1)

Getlik, Matth?us,Smil, David,Zepeda-Velázquez, Carlos,Bolshan, Yuri,Poda, Gennady,Wu, Hong,Dong, Aiping,Kuznetsova, Ekaterina,Marcellus, Richard,Senisterra, Guillermo,Dombrovski, Ludmila,Hajian, Taraneh,Kiyota, Taira,Schapira, Matthieu,Arrowsmith, Cheryl H.,Brown, Peter J.,Vedadi, Masoud,Al-Awar, Rima

supporting information, p. 2478 - 2496 (2016/04/10)

WD repeat-containing protein 5 (WDR5) is an important component of the multiprotein complex essential for activating mixed-lineage leukemia 1 (MLL1). Rearrangement of the MLL1 gene is associated with onset and progression of acute myeloid and lymphoblastic leukemias, and targeting the WDR5-MLL1 interaction may result in new cancer therapeutics. Our previous work showed that binding of small molecule ligands to WDR5 can modulate its interaction with MLL1, suppressing MLL1 methyltransferase activity. Initial structure-activity relationship studies identified N-(2-(4-methylpiperazin-1-yl)-5-substituted-phenyl) benzamides as potent and selective antagonists of this protein-protein interaction. Guided by crystal structure data and supported by in silico library design, we optimized the scaffold by varying the C-1 benzamide and C-5 substituents. This allowed us to develop the first highly potent (Kdisp 100 nM) small molecule antagonists of the WDR5-MLL1 interaction and demonstrate that N-(4-(4-methylpiperazin-1-yl)-3′-(morpholinomethyl)-[1,1′-biphenyl]-3-yl)-6-oxo-4-(trifluoromethyl)-1,6-dihydropyridine-3-carboxamide 16d (OICR-9429) is a potent and selective chemical probe suitable to help dissect the biological role of WDR5.

Synthesis of racemic 1,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inolines and their resolution

Suna,Trapencieris

, p. 287 - 300 (2007/10/03)

1-Aniline-substituted 3,4-dihydroisoquinolines were obtained in various ways using the Bischler-Napieralski reaction. The effect of the protecting group at the aniline nitrogen atom on the course of the reaction has been studied and it was found that the N-phthalyl group was stable under the cyclization conditions. The dihydroisoquinolines were reduced to the racemic 1,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inolines which were resolved by crystallization of the diastereomeric tartrates. Two examples of 1,2,3, 4-tetrahydroisoquinolines were obtained in optically pure form (>99% ee).
